Why Outdated Tech Should Not Be Ignored:

Currently, U.S. universities only average a 24% recycling rate, leaving a large portion of waste improperly disposed of. Those old laptops, monitors, and hard drives might look harmless, but they can carry serious risks. Most electronics contain toxic materials like lead, cadmium, and mercury. When these items are sent to landfills or improperly handled, they can leak into the environment and create lasting damage.

There is also the issue of data. Many devices still hold sensitive information, including student records, financial details, or internal documents. Simply storing them does not solve the problem. Proper data destruction is essential for compliance and protection.
